摘要
以凤滩水力发电厂一副厂房为例,基于梁元和壳元建立空间有限元仿真模型计算了厂房的动力特性和几种工况下的动力响应,并进行了相应工况的动态测试,对测试结果与计算成果进行了比较。研究表明,测试结果可靠,分析模型正确,找到了该厂房砖混结构开裂为振动过大所致,提出了相应的振动控制策略,为类似结构的振动安全性研究提供了参考。
In this paper, a 3D FEM model is built up for the analysis of the dynamical characteristics of a industrial structure, the tested results on the dynamic properties of auxiliarg plant of the the structute are compared with its results computed by the FEM model, it is shown that both the results are agreed. Finally, vibration control measures of the concrete masonry plant are suggested for reducing vibration of the plant .
